Athens Achieves Job Portal Launched at AthensAchieves.com
On January 26, the Athens Area Chamber of Commerce launched the latest piece of our Athens Achieves initiative: the Athens Achieves Job Portal. Now live at AthensAchieves.com, this job portal aims to be a valuable resource for job seekers and employers alike, connecting local talent to local jobs. GACCE Announces 2026 Staff Service Award Recipients
The Georgia Association of Chamber of Commerce Executives (GACCE) recognized its 2026 Staff Service Award recipients during its Staff Development Conference held this week in Dalton, GA. The Service Awards recognize those chamber staff members in Georgia who have achieved significant years of service in the chamber of commerce industry. 12 Miles of Trail Highlight Athens Physical Therapy Firefly Trail Ticket to Ride March 28th
The 15th Annual Athens Physical Therapy Firefly Trail Ticket to Ride cycling event will roll out of Athens, Winterville and Union Point on March 28 to celebrate the 12 miles of trail already open and raise funds and support to complete the remaining 27 miles of the 39-mile rail-trail. The cycling fun begins Saturday, March 28, with cyclists starting at 9 a.m. in Union Point and 10 a.m. in Athens and Winterville. Dr. David Woodbury to join St. Mary’s Orthopedic Specialists
St. Mary’s Medical Group is proud to announce that David Woodbury, MD, FAAOS, is joining St. Mary’s Orthopedic Specialists effective March 16, 2026. Dr. Woodbury is an Orthopedic sports surgeon and has more than 26 years of experience in both military and private practice. He comes to St. Mary’s from Longstreet Clinic in Gainesville, Ga., where he has practiced Orthopedic sports medicine and adult reconstruction since 2021.
